Puedes controlar la generación de respuestas de varias maneras según tu caso de uso y el nivel de control que necesites.
Diseño de instrucciones
Obtén información sobre el diseño de instrucciones para que puedas influir en el modelo para generar resultados específicos para tus necesidades.
Por ejemplo, aprende a proporcionar información pertinente asociada con la tarea de forma estructurada.
Configuración del modelo
Establece una configuración del modelo para controlar cómo el modelo genera una respuesta. Las opciones de configuración dependen del modelo y la capacidad que estés usando.
En el caso de los modelos Gemini, puedes configurar parámetros como la cantidad máxima de tokens de salida, la temperatura, Top-K y Top-P. Si usas la Gemini Live API o un Gemini modelo capaz de generar resultados multimodales, también puedes configurar el tipo de respuesta (audio, texto o imágenes) y la voz que se usa en las respuestas de audio.
En el caso de los modelos Gemini capaces de pensar, también puedes especificar una configuración relacionada con el pensamiento, incluido un presupuesto de pensamiento y si se deben incluir resúmenes de pensamiento.
En el caso de los modelos Imagen, puedes configurar parámetros como la cantidad de imágenes que se generarán, la relación de aspecto, agregar una marca de agua, etcétera.
Configuración de seguridad
Usa la configuración de seguridad para ajustar la probabilidad de obtener respuestas que puedan considerarse dañinas. Esta configuración puede ayudarte a controlar los resultados para posibles incitaciones al odio o a la violencia, hostigamiento, contenido sexual explícito y contenido peligroso.
Por ejemplo, puedes bloquear las respuestas que promuevan o habiliten el acceso a bienes, servicios y actividades perjudiciales.
Instrucciones del sistema
Establece instrucciones del sistema para dirigir el comportamiento del modelo. Esta función es como un "preámbulo" que agregas antes de que el modelo se exponga a otras instrucciones del usuario final.
Por ejemplo, puedes indicarle al modelo que devuelva respuestas como si fuera un pirata o que devuelva respuestas en un formato específico.
Salida estructurada con el esquema de respuesta
Pasa un esquema de respuesta junto con la instrucción para especificar un esquema de salida específico. Esta función se usa con mayor frecuencia cuando se genera una salida JSON, pero también se puede usar para tareas de clasificación (como cuando quieres que el modelo use etiquetas específicas).